Joel Allen Dewey (September 20, 1840 – June 17, 1873) was a Union Army colonel during the American Civil War. He was appointed a brigadier general of volunteers in November 1865, after the conclusion of the war, but he was mustered out on January 31, 1866 before his appointment was confirmed by the U.S. Senate on February 23, 1866. He was a post-war lawyer and district attorney general in Tennessee.
